Changes for page ListWebSearch

Last modified by Ecaterina Valica on 2010/07/22 10:30

From version 143.1
edited by Ecaterina Valica
on 2009/03/18 13:40
Change comment: There is no comment for this version
To version 165.1
edited by Ecaterina Valica
on 2009/03/19 15:39
Change comment: There is no comment for this version

Summary

Details

Page properties
Content
... ... @@ -33,15 +33,15 @@
33 33   #set($url = $xwiki.getURL("Main.WebSearchRss", "view", "xpage=rdf&space=$space&text=${utext}"))
34 34  #end
35 35  <div id="search">
36 -<form action="">
36 +<div id="searchBar">
37 +<form action="" id="searchBarForm">
37 37   {pre}
38 - <div id="searchBar">
39 - <input type="text" name="text" value="$xwiki.getFormEncoded($!text)" size="50"/>
39 + <input type="text" name="text" value="Search..." size="50"/>
40 40   #spaceselect($space $spaces $spacesText) <input type="submit" value="Search"/>
41 41   <div class="searchHelp">eq. xwiki* AND "search query"</div>
42 - </div>
43 43   {/pre}
44 44  </form>
44 +</div>
45 45  #includeInContext("XWiki.WebSearchCode")
46 46  #includeInContext("XWiki.ListResults")
47 47  </div>
XWiki.StyleSheetExtension[0]
Code
... ... @@ -22,13 +22,15 @@
22 22  .searchFilters{
23 23   clear: both;
24 24   margin-bottom: 15px;
25 + font-size: 90%;
25 25  }
26 26  #sortFilter{
27 27   color: #808080;
28 - background-color: #e6e6e6;
29 + background-color: #F9F9F9;
29 29   padding: 5px;
31 + line-height: 16px;
30 30  }
31 -#sortFilter a{
33 +#sortFilter a.sortType{
32 32   color: #808080;
33 33  }
34 34  #sortFilter a:hover{
... ... @@ -42,10 +42,11 @@
42 42  .paginationFilter {
43 43   color: #808080;
44 44   height: 100%;
45 - background-color: #f2f2f2;
46 - border-top: 2px solid #b3b3b3;
47 + background-color: #F9F9F9;
48 + border-top: 1px solid #CCCCCC;
47 47   padding: 5px;
48 48   display: block;
51 + line-height: 22px;
49 49  }
50 50  .resultsNo{
51 51   float: left;
... ... @@ -55,6 +55,7 @@
55 55  }
56 56  .pagination{
57 57   float: right;
61 + margin-right: 10px;
58 58  }
59 59  .pagination a{
60 60   color: #808080;
... ... @@ -67,26 +67,38 @@
67 67   color: #777777;
68 68   font-weight: bold;
69 69  }
70 -.pagination .controlPagination{}
71 71  .controlPagination{
72 72   position:relative;
73 - width:44px;
74 - height:26px;
76 + width:41px;
77 + height:22px;
75 75   overflow:hidden;
76 76   margin:0!important;
77 77   padding:0!important;
78 78   list-style:none;
79 - background-position:left top;
80 - background-image:url($xwiki.getSkinFile("navigation.png")) left -1000px;
82 + background-image:url($xwiki.getSkinFile("navigation.png"));
83 + float: right;
81 81  }
82 82  .controlPagination li{
83 83   display:inline;
84 84  }
88 +.controlPagination a{
89 + position:absolute;
90 + top:0;
91 + left:0;
92 + text-indent:-1000em;
93 + height:25px;
94 + line-height:25px;
95 + outline:none;
96 + overflow:hidden;
97 + border:none;
98 +}
85 85  a.prevPagination {
86 86   width: 50%;
101 + z-index: 2;
87 87  }
88 88  a.nextPagination {
89 - width: 50%;
104 + width: 100%;
105 + z-index: 1;
90 90  }
91 91  /* Search Filters*/
92 92  #searchResultsList{
... ... @@ -106,13 +106,13 @@
106 106   width: 3%;
107 107  }
108 108  .itemType .typeComment{
109 - background:transparent url($xwiki.getSkinFile("comment.gif")) center right no-repeat;
125 + background:transparent url($xwiki.getSkinFile("comment.png")) center right no-repeat;
110 110   display:inline-block;
111 111   width:16px;
112 112   height:16px;
113 113  }
114 114  .itemType .typeAttachment{
115 - background:transparent url($xwiki.getSkinFile("attach.gif")) center right no-repeat;
131 + background:transparent url($xwiki.getSkinFile("attach.png")) center right no-repeat;
116 116   display:inline-block;
117 117   width:16px;
118 118   height:16px;
... ... @@ -131,7 +131,7 @@
131 131  .itemDescription a{
132 132   color: #5599ff;
133 133  }
134 -.itemTitle{
150 +.itemTitle a{
135 135   color: #4d4d4d;
136 136   font-weight: bold;
137 137   font-size:130%;
... ... @@ -242,10 +242,8 @@
242 242   display: block;
243 243   clear: both;
244 244   text-align: right;
261 + font-size: 90%;
245 245  }
246 -.searchFooter .pagination {
247 - width: 100%;
248 -}
249 249  .divClosure {
250 250   background-color: transparent;
251 251   clear: both;